Output 5d824868af1ec32da09ed7cbc1549f718a725d7728b9d9323e9ad45ee1cd463e:1

value
11446811
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e50558f1286c1e9a2b2a20889012e2be4e5336e9dc8197574b52940a54785098
address
tb1pu5z43ufgds0f52e2yzyfqyhzhe89xdhfmjqew46t222q54rc2zvqdy8sdc
transaction
5d824868af1ec32da09ed7cbc1549f718a725d7728b9d9323e9ad45ee1cd463e
confirmations
11809
spent
true